tests/qtests: clean-up and fix leak in generic_fuzz
authorAlex Bennée <alex.bennee@linaro.org>
Fri, 30 Jun 2023 18:03:53 +0000 (19:03 +0100)
committerAlex Bennée <alex.bennee@linaro.org>
Mon, 3 Jul 2023 11:51:26 +0000 (12:51 +0100)
An update to the clang tooling detects more issues with the code
including a memory leak from the g_string_new() allocation. Clean up
the code to avoid the allocation and use ARRAY_SIZE while we are at
it.
